Cody Alexander Obituary

Alexander, Cody

January 13, 1998 - September 26, 2023

Cody Alexander (formerly Janke), 25, of San Tan Valley, AZ, was born in Omaha, on January 13, 1998, and relocated to heaven on September 26, 2023. He is survived and deeply missed by his mother, Angela Longenecker (Kellen); sister, Chelsea Janke (Connor Mally); stepbrothers, Kyle Longenecker (Traci), Todd Longenecker (Brooke); his very loved significant other, Wyntur Zweygardt; and the family fur baby, Echo.

We cannot capture the essence of who Cody was in mere words, we will always remember him as an incredibly loving, kind and compassionate man who impacted the lives of those around him. He is, and will always be, deeply loved and will be remembered for his amazing heart and caring nature. He was intensely loyal to those that he loved. We will cherish the memories shared with him.

A CELEBRATION OF LIFE will be held at a later date. For more information about the Celebration of Life, please reach out to Cody's mom, stepdad, or sister.

May Cody rest in paradise.
